Is cash still widely used?
Yes, outside resorts. All-inclusive resort zones (Punta Cana, Puerto Plata) are largely card-based. But in Santo Domingo’s colonial zone, local colmados, guaguas (buses), and everyday Dominican life, peso cash is essential.
ATMs and withdrawing cash
ATMs are widely available in cities and resort areas. Banco Popular and BHD León machines accept foreign cards.
- Fees are around 200 DOP per withdrawal for foreign cards
- Excellent availability in resort areas and Santo Domingo
- USD is also widely accepted in tourist areas
Card acceptance
Good at resorts and tourist businesses. Local transport, markets, and smaller restaurants require pesos.
Tips for travelers
- Carry pesos for anything outside resort zones
- USD is widely accepted but you’ll receive change in pesos
- Tipping 10% is expected in restaurants — often added automatically
